  • Patent number: 9025500
    Abstract: Disclosed are methods, systems, and apparatus for maximizing the spectral efficiency of a communications spectrum by providing a means to transmit information continuously in both directions of a radio link on the same center frequency at any given time. One embodiment may be directed to a method of communicating in a point-to-point radio system. The method may include receiving a first signal at a first antenna of a radio head. The first signal may include a transmitted data signal and interfering signals. The method continues by determining a correction signal from a transmitter of the radio head and processing the first signal to remove the interfering signals using the correction signal, and sending a second signal using a second antenna. The first and second signals may be sent and received at substantially the same time.

  • Patent number: 8750792
    Abstract: Embodiments of the present invention are directed to methods, apparatuses, and systems for implementing a point-to-point radio architecture in which the isolation needed between the transmitter and receiver may be achieved through the use of separate antennas. One embodiment is directed at a radio head comprising a transmitter configured to operate at a first frequency, a receiver configured to operate at a second frequency, and a processor coupled to both the transmitter and the receiver. The transmitter is further coupled to a first antenna interface coupled to a first antenna configured to transmit signals at the first frequency. The receiver is further coupled to a second antenna interface coupled to a second antenna configured to receive signals at the second frequency.

  • Patent number: 5455565
    Abstract: A non-invasive, fluid monitor engages an open resonator with a segment of fluid line. The fluid line is disposed such that it and the fluid within become a part of the dielectric loading on the resonator. The open resonator is a part of an oscillator circuit that changes frequency of oscillation in response to the dielectric loading on the resonator. A frequency discriminator monitors the frequency of the oscillator to detect an air bubble in the fluid line. In the case where the resonator comprises a microstrip line, the microstrip line is disposed in parallel to the segment of the fluid line and the length of the microstrip line is selected to be equal to or greater than the maximum length of air bubble permitted thus providing a volumetric air-in-line sensor. The output of the frequency discriminator is compared to a threshold to determine a frequency shift large enough to indicate the presence of an air bubble.
